Mobile Therapy Centers of America is Hiring a Clinical Director - Counseling Dept (LCPC, LCSW, QMHP) Near Libertyville, IL

Mobile Therapy Centers (MTC) are a private practice with a progressive service delivery model, where the therapists come to the client. Over the last 17 years, Mobile Therapy Centers has evolved from a single therapist offering a single service to employing over 100 health professionals, who provide a multitude of high-quality customized therapeutic services (ABA Therapy, Speech Therapy, Occupational Therapy, Behavioral Therapy and Counseling) for children, teens, adults, and families.

Mobile Therapy Centers (MTC) is looking for a BH Department Clinical Director. This position is responsible for overseeing the BH Department and the execution and implementation of Clinical Programs’ strategy and goals and the oversight of Clinical Programs’ operations. The incumbent oversees the effective integration and continuous improvement of processes and systems to meet MTC’s current and future business goals. Responsibilities also include managing and developing a team of clinical and support staff promoting their professional growth and operational effectiveness. Maintain caseload productivity requirements (adjusted based on offsite client responsibilities) within clinic/telesession anticipated avg 20 hours/week completed sessions, may be adjusted based on supervision.

Principal Duties and Responsibilities:

Direct Treatment Duties:

· Provide direct screening/consultation, evaluation, treatment and support of social/emotional disorders to clients on caseload.

· Complete and finalize daily and quarterly documentation associated with respective dates of service.

Direct Management Duties:

· Assign clients to counseling department team members based on provider experience and weighted caseload.

· Participate in development of clinical program’s strategy and planning in accordance with company's mission and strategic goals, federal and state law and regulations, and accreditation standards of NASW and ACA.

  • Assist in the selection and ongoing training, evaluation, and development of professional team members.
  • Provide team member training and performance review of job functions, which may include: preauthorization, client case management, retrospective claim review, supervision, discharge procedures and delegated management oversight.
  • Reports abuse, neglect, domestic violence and other required cases to appropriate authorities and provides education and guidance to other mandated reporters when they encounter abuse and neglect patient cases.
  • Documents and participates in follow up discussion regarding unusual occurrences and client relations issues; makes appropriate referrals to HR & other internal departments.
  • Participate in the development and monitoring of budgets in accordance with department and organizational objectives.
  • Training and supervision of new (discipline specific) department staff on procedures and general workplace policies (as needed).
  • Weekly meeting with department leadership members to collaborate and review caseload status and clinical department goals accordingly.
  • Participate in the development, implementation, and monitoring of the department's performance standards, utilizing quality improvement methodologies to refine procedures & policies as required.
  • Foster collaborative work environment that encourages team building, facilitates cohesive synergetic performance of department functions, while valuing the individual diversity and uniqueness of all employees.
  • Maintains current knowledge of resources available in the community to support a continuum of effective services for the clients.
  • Contribute discipline specific content to across internal MTC departments to increase awareness, collaboration and respect of multidisciplinary approach to wellness.
  • Build and maintain cooperative business relationships.
